Gauteng police have condemned the shooting of guns in the air at a car dealership in Kensington, Johannesburg.

Police spokesperson Mavela Masondo says the gunshots were fired by the loved ones of a fallen taxi driver who was gunned down outside the car dealership on Sunday.

"It alleged that the family of the person that was shot and killed in Kensington last week went to spot where he died to perform a ritual.
"They then started shooting randomly where the body was found.”

Police are investigating a case of the discharging of a firearm in a public space.
An eyewitness, who preferred to remain anonymous, told Jacaranda FM News that he heard gunshots near the dealership.
"It seemed to be a taxi funeral, the guys were firing shots in the air."
